What is the difference between Internship Next Js Developer vs Junior Next Js Developer?

AspectInternship Next Js DeveloperJunior Next Js Developer
Required CredentialsBasic knowledge of Next.js, HTML, CSS, JavaScript; often enrolled in or recent graduateProven understanding of Next.js, JavaScript, and related frameworks; some project experience
Work EnvironmentLearning-focused, supervised, part-time or temporaryFull-time, collaborative team environment, more independent responsibilities
Employer & Industry UsageInternships offered by tech companies, startups, or agencies for trainingEntry-level roles in tech companies, startups, and digital agencies

The main difference between an Internship Next Js Developer and a Junior Next Js Developer lies in experience and responsibilities. Internships are designed for learners gaining foundational skills, often with supervision, while Junior developers have more hands-on responsibilities and some project experience. Both roles are common in tech industries, but internships focus on training, whereas junior roles involve contributing to ongoing projects.

Ford Energy is a newly formed, wholly-owned subsidiary of Ford Motor Company dedicated to accelerating U.S. energy independence. Leveraging Ford's century of manufacturing excellence and world-class battery energy storage systems (BESS) technology, Ford Energy designs, manufactures, and services grid-scale and commercial DC battery energy storage systems (BESS). Ford Energy is uniquely positioned to capture the growing demand for reliable, US-built energy storage systems. We are not just building batteries; we are building the infrastructure for the next generation of the American grid.

What you'll do...

  • Lead cross functional projects concentrated around material flow and component packaging that interfaces with both automation and manufacturing operators
  • Work with Ford Purchasing and fabrication suppliers to quote, analyze bids, and procure production fleets
  • Monitor packaging development(s) progress, including fabricator quality and planning to ensure developments meet standards and expectations 
  • Forecasting and management of operating expense and capital budgets
  • Schedule and complete transportation testing. Work with our test engineer to determine test criteria and document pass/fail conditions. If required, develop and implement an action plan to correct any issues identified during testing
  • Lead Kaizen activities to optimize returnable and disposable packaging fleets
  • Improve part protection, functionality, density and durability
  • Advance the science and discipline of packaging engineering through the pursuit of new technologies, methods, and ideas
